The Mechanics of the Crash: How Aviator Works in 2026

The screen loads. A red plane sits on the runway. The multiplier reads 1.00x. The round begins, and the aircraft ascends, pulling the multiplier up with it—1.05x, 1.45x, 2.10x. Your finger hovers over the cash out button. Do you lock in a modest profit, or do you ride the wave toward a 10x payout, knowing the plane could vanish into the stratosphere at any millisecond?

This is the core loop of Spribe’s Aviator, the undisputed king of crash games. The 2026 iteration of the game remains true to its roots, relying on a Provably Fair Random Number Generator (RNG) to determine the exact moment the plane flies away. There are no reels to spin, no paylines to memorize. The entire outcome rests on a single variable: when the round ends.

The mathematics governing the crash point are brutal but transparent. Every round generates a hash seed that players can verify, ensuring the operator cannot manipulate the flight path. The multiplier curve accelerates exponentially. The difference between 1.00x and 2.00x takes noticeably longer to traverse than the jump from 2.00x to 4.00x. This exponential acceleration is designed to exploit human greed. The higher the plane goes, the harder it becomes to press that cash out button.

Understanding the Return to Player (RTP) is crucial. Aviator operates with a theoretical RTP of 97%. This means that for every €100 wagered across millions of rounds, the game pays back €97. The house edge sits at a slim 3%. However, this RTP is only achievable if players cash out consistently. If you chase the elusive 100x multipliers every round, your personal RTP will plummet. The game’s architecture demands discipline.

The live aspect adds a thick layer of psychological pressure. As the plane climbs, a live chat feed scrolls with reactions from other players. You see someone hit a 12.50x multiplier. You see someone else complain that the plane crashed at 1.02x. This social proof can trigger FOMO (Fear Of Missing Out), pushing you to hold your bet longer than your strategy dictates. Recognizing this psychological trap is the first step toward profitable play.

The Low-Risk Grind

This strategy targets frequent, small multipliers. Set your auto cash out to 1.30x or 1.40x. The probability of the plane reaching 1.30x is significantly higher than reaching 5.00x. The payout is small, but the win rate is high. This approach suits players with smaller bankrolls who want to extend their playtime. The danger here is complacency; a sudden streak of early crashes at 1.10x can erode your balance if you aren't paying attention.

The Dual-Bet Approach

Aviator allows you to place two simultaneous bets per round. Sharp players use this to hedge their risk. Bet one unit with an auto cash out at 1.50x to secure your initial stake. Bet a second unit with a higher target, perhaps 3.00x or 5.00x, to chase a larger profit. If the plane crashes early, you lose both bets. If it hits 1.50x, you break even or secure a tiny profit. If it hits your second target, you bank a substantial win.

The Martingale Trap

Some players attempt to use the Martingale system—doubling the bet after every loss. In Aviator, this is financial suicide. A streak of 10 early crashes is entirely possible. If you start with a €5 bet, a 10-round losing streak requires an 11th bet of €2,560. Table limits and bankroll constraints will destroy this strategy before it succeeds. Avoid it entirely.

Maximizing Your Bankroll: Odds, RTP, and Bonuses

Understanding the numbers behind the neon graphics is what separates the gamblers from the strategists. The 97% RTP is a theoretical ceiling. Your goal is to get your personal RTP as close to that number as possible.

The odds of hitting specific multipliers follow a predictable curve. The chance of the plane crashing at 2.00x is roughly 49%. The chance of hitting 10.00x is around 9%. Hitting a 100x multiplier occurs less than 1% of the time. These statistics should inform your auto cash out settings. Aiming for 2.00x gives you a near coin-flip chance of doubling your money. Aiming for 10.00x means you will lose nine out of ten rounds on average.

The house edge is a mathematical certainty over millions of rounds. Your only edge is discipline. Cash out when the math says you should, not when your gut tells you to.

Bonuses add another layer to the math. Welcome bonuses and deposit matches provide extra ammunition, but they come with rollover requirements. If a bonus carries a 30x rollover, you must wager the bonus amount 30 times before withdrawing. Using bonus funds on Aviator can be highly effective because the game has a high RTP. You can grind through the rollover requirements by placing low-risk bets targeting 1.20x multipliers. However, always check the terms. Some promotions exclude crash games or cap the bet size while a bonus is active.

Bankroll management is the ultimate strategy. Divide your total bankroll into 100 units. Never bet more than 1 or 2 units per round. If you hit a losing streak, your bankroll depletes slowly, giving you time to recover. If you bet 10 units per round, a short streak of bad luck wipes you out. Treat Aviator like a high-paced trading floor. Protect your capital, take your profits, and never let a single round ruin your session.

Pros and Cons of Playing Aviator

Every casino game has trade-offs. Aviator’s unique format brings specific advantages and risks.

Pros

  • High RTP: A 97% RTP is significantly higher than most slot machines.
  • Player Control: You decide when to cash out. The game does not force a payout on you.
  • Provably Fair: The RNG is transparent and verifiable. You know the game isn't rigged.
  • Fast Paced: Rounds last only a few seconds, allowing for rapid gameplay.
  • Social Interaction: The live chat and shared multiplier feed create a communal atmosphere.

Cons

  • Psychological Pressure: The urge to hold out for a bigger multiplier can lead to devastating losses.
  • Variance: Even with a high RTP, short-term variance can be brutal. Long losing streaks happen.
  • Addictive Loop: The rapid pace of the game makes it easy to lose track of time and money.
  • No Skill Element: Strategy is about money management, not influencing the outcome. The plane flies when it flies.

How does the dual-bet feature work?+
The dual-bet feature allows you to place two separate wagers on the same round. You can set different stake amounts and different auto cash out targets for each bet. This is commonly used to hedge risk: one bet cashes out early to cover the stake, while the second bet targets a higher multiplier for profit. It adds a layer of complexity to your strategy.

Are the game results truly random?+
Yes. Aviator uses Provably Fair technology. Before each round, the system generates a hash seed. After the round concludes, players can verify this seed to ensure the operator did not alter the crash point. This cryptographic transparency guarantees that every flight is determined by pure chance and cannot be manipulated by the casino.

What happens if my internet disconnects mid-round?+
If your connection drops after you have placed a bet, the round will continue. If you have set an auto cash out, the system will automatically execute it if the multiplier reaches your target. If you were relying on a manual cash out and disconnect, you will lose the bet if the plane crashes before you reconnect. Auto cash out is highly recommended to prevent technical issues from costing you money.
